What this data means

Reading this record

Everything above comes from two different AIS transmissions. Position, speed, course and heading arrive in message 1, 2 or 3, broadcast every few seconds while under way — that is why the position age above can be very small. Name, MMSI, IMO number, call sign, type and dimensions arrive in a separate static report — message 5 for a Class A transponder, message 24 for Class B — sent only around once every six minutes. A vessel can therefore show a fresh position with an old or missing static report, or the reverse.

Nothing here is estimated, interpolated, or carried over from a previous ship at the same MMSI. Where the vessel did not transmit a field, or transmitted a value the standard defines as "not available", we print “Not reported” rather than guess.
